Shellfish harvesting definition

Shellfish harvesting means taking of bivalve mollusks, specifically clams, mussels, or oysters, for direct marketing or human consumption.

  • Shellfish harvesting closures have been required due to DSP toxins in excess of the established regulatory guidance level of 16 µg OA eq./100 g shellfish on the Texas Gulf Coast since 2008, in the Puget Sound region since 2011, and in the New England region since 2015.

  • Shellfish harvesting areas that do not meet the NSSP bacteria water quality standard for an approved classification (a fecal coliform median of 14 mpn/100 ml and a 90th percentile of <49) are classified as restricted and listed as impaired in Category 4 or 5 (depending on whether a TMDL was completed or not) of the IR.
